Guwahati: As the entire state is drowning in Maa Durga's devotion for the 5 days puja celebration, Pragya Foundation is celebrating "Bharat Mata Pujan '' in Guwahati this year too. Every year during the Durga puja festival, pragya foundation organises Bharat Mata Puja and Guru Puja in Guwahati. The Bharat Mata Pujan starts on the Sasthi puja and continues till Dashami. Chief minister Himanta Biswa Sarma on Monday took part in the Bharat Mata Pujan and Guru Puja organised at Srimanta Sankardev Kalakshetra. 

Speaking on the occasion CM Dr Sarma said, “The aim of Sanatan life is to empower me with knowledge and wisdom, eradicating the darkness and ignorance. The best way to reach this aim is by Margdarshan of Gurus. I sincerely offer my prayers to all Gurus to show us the right path of truth and supreme knowledge, and take an oath to not stray from the right path." Several known personalities and film and television actors, singers took part in the Bharat Mata Pujan samaroh in Guwahati.

On the occasion of the Maha Saptami, CM Himanta Biswa Sarma visited several Puja Pandals in Silchar and offered his prayer. 

He also visited the famous Kanchakanti Devi Mandir, Udharbond in Cachar and prayed for the well being of all.
